My dog got Bravecto and NexGard. Is it safe to combine them?

Updated On September 23rd, 2025

Pet's info: Dog | White Shepherd | Female | 5 years and 6 months old | 55 lbs

Hi there, I have been taking care of a stray dog for the past few days. At the vet they gave her Bravecto because she was found with many ticks. They had described this as something that would kill off existing fleas and ticks. At home I had some flea and tick preventive medicine, NexGard, so I just gave the dog one of those as well. Once I got to thinking a bit I realized I should have researched what Bravecto was exactly and found they are essentially the same medication. Will the dog be okay?

Yes, they do cover the same things, the only difference is a nexgardnwill last for 1 month and a bravecto will last for 3 months. They have different ingredients and a wide safety margin so you will unlikely notice any changes.
